An account executive is assembling a client’s campaign using ads aimed to reach both mobile and desktop devices.What technology would they need to use in order to accomplish this?

Correct answer: They would need to use HTML5 format..
Why this is the answer
HTML5 is the correct technology because it is a versatile web language that supports responsive design, allowing ads to adapt seamlessly across various screen sizes and devices, including both mobile and desktop. This ensures a consistent user experience regardless of the platform. Native apps are incorrect because they are standalone applications built for specific operating systems (like iOS or Android) and are not used for creating cross-platform ad creatives that run in web browsers. Display & Video 360 Marketplace is a platform for buying ad inventory, not a technology for creating ad formats. MP4-encoded video is a specific video file format and while it can be part of an ad, it's not the overarching technology that enables cross-device compatibility for the entire ad creative; HTML5 provides that framework.
